Solemates to launch new spa sandal
POSTED 25 Aug 2005 . BY
Irish company Solemates™, which introduced the innovative reflexology Flight Slipper, will be launching the reflexology Well Being Sandal in 2006.

The principle of the new sandal is based on a series of specifically placed protrusions which are designed to stimulate reflex points on the sole of the foot corresponding to the heart, lungs, shoulders and lower body.

The stimulation of these 7,200 nerve endings is said to persuade the body to naturally and non-invasively correct itself, resulting in increased circulation which in turn eliminates toxins, decreases levels of stress and anxiety and enhances an overall deep sense of relaxation, harmony and balance.

Solemates says the Well Being Sandal - which can be worn in the morning to help invigorate circulation, and in the evening to promote relaxation - can benefit almost anyone who suffers from bad circulation or who remains seated for long periods of time - in a car, bus or train for instance, or those with a sedentary job.

Washable and with a non-slip sole, the sandal comes in three sizes - Small, Medium and Large - and the PVC from which it is made is treated with both tea tree oil and lemongrass essential oils to guard against veruccas and similar foot related problems.

The company's Flight Slipper is the subject of a worldwide distribution agreement with the Aviation Health Institute - leading authority in flying related health issues - and Solemates is focusing on making the new sandal equally as accessible to the growing holistically-driven 'every day wear' sector.
